Output 95596c327cb38ff8c45a008457921d646ba883a9e17a17e16ae48201caf8e85e:1

value
4433862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0553c3fc789c0746c2e7b418d93df5f8b00dd6db OP_EQUAL
address
32BBedtXZM8CVuLrQgejhRKkH2tmUA8ib4
transaction
95596c327cb38ff8c45a008457921d646ba883a9e17a17e16ae48201caf8e85e
spent
true